Oduetse Leshogo is an experienced aviation professional currently serving as Chief Pilot and Acting Director of Flight Operations at Air Botswana since February 2019. With a robust career that began at Air Botswana in 2007, Oduetse has held multiple leadership roles including Director of Flight Operations and Manager of Flight Standards, in addition to previous experience as a Line Captain at Nesma Airlines. Oduetse's educational background includes a Commercial Pilot Licence from Air Service Training Ltd (UK), an Airline Transport Pilot Licence and Diploma in Aircraft Operations from Comair Aviation Academy (USA), and a Master of Science in Air Transport Management from City St George’s, University of London. Oduetse also holds a Level 7 Diploma in Professional Consulting from the Chartered Management Institute.

Air Botswana is the country's national airline. The airline operates and maintains a fleet of four aircraft, that includes an Embraer 170 Jet, ATR42-500 and two ATR72-600 advanced turbo propeller aircrafts which operate the domestic and regional scheduled flights. The airline is implementing an ambitious new strategy that will take it into the future and become a force to reckon with regionally and internationally, with aspirations to be counted amongst Africa's top 10 airlines.
